We're looking for an Export Coordinator / Administrator to join a busy team, supporting the worldwide export of spares and repairs. You'll play an important role in ensuring shipments are processed accurately, on time and in line with customer requirements and export regulations. Based in Yeovil, this is a temporary role and the team currently work hybrid, 3 days in the office and 2 days at home (training will be full time in the office). What you'll be doing: Coordinating worldwide exports of spares and repairs to customers and suppliers. Preparing export documentation to meet HM Revenue & Customs and Department for Business & Trade requirements, as well as customer-specific requirements. Producing shipping documents that comply with contractual and country-specific regulations. Ensuring documentation meets Letter of Credit requirements where applicable. Completing export entries using the GTS system where required. Monitoring customer orders to ensure goods are despatched on time and in line with agreed service levels. Acting as a point of contact for internal departments, responding to queries efficiently. Keeping stakeholders updated on shipment progress and delivery arrangements. Ensuring export procedures, including export licences and commodity codes, are followed correctly. Liaising with packing contractors to ensure goods are prepared for shipment within agreed timescales. Booking air, sea and road freight with freight forwarders and customer-appointed agents. Checking freight invoices against agreed rates before processing for payment. Maintaining accurate export records and departmental documentation. Ensuring shipping documentation is issued and distributed in line with company procedures. Identifying opportunities to improve processes and ways of working. Supporting colleagues within the Export team and providing cover during periods of absence or increased workload. What we're looking for: Previous experience in an Export Coordinator, Shipping Administrator, Logistics Administrator or similar administration role. Experience within a shipping or distribution environment would be beneficial. Strong administration and organisational skills. Excellent communication and interpersonal skills. Good attention to detail and the ability to manage multiple tasks. Confident using Microsoft Word, Excel and SAP (SAP is desirable) A proactive approach with a focus on delivering excellent customer service.

Trade Compliance Coordinator Salary: Negotiable depending on experience Location: Heathrow Area Position: Permanent, Full Time Start Date: ASAP About the Role: Due to continued global growth, our client is seeking a Trade Compliance Coordinator to join their Heathrow team. This is an excellent opportunity to join a well-established international freight forwarding and logistics organisation with strong family values and a long-standing reputation within the industry. What you'll do: As Trade Compliance Coordinator you will support key account trade compliance functions with KPI and product reporting. Main Responsibilities: Ensure all Trade Compliance reports and KPIs are completed accurately and within deadlines Determine correct tariff classifications for supported brands moving from the EU Issue UK-specific import guidance to the business Liaise with HMRC and assist with maintenance of customs procedures Complete Import, Export, Transit, ICS and ENS declarations in line with regulations Audit and monitor entries to ensure compliance with import/export legislation Maintenance of the CITES portal, uploading Import and Re-Export CITES certificates Create and maintain written procedures and SOPs Implement and improve new efficiencies in client workflow in conjunction with line manager Report sales leads to the Line Manager for distribution to the Sales Team Complete ad-hoc and spot checks on entries and submit reports to line manager and Head of Department weekly Maintain excellent relationships with customers and internal departments What you need: Experience within customs or trade compliance in a large organisation or brokerage environment In-depth understanding of UK & EU customs regulations and documentation Knowledge of CITES import/export permits (desirable) Strong understanding of commodity codes, incoterms, valuation and preference Intermediate to strong Excel skills Excellent communication skills across all levels Strong organisational skills with high attention to detail Ability to work independently and as part of a team Proactive, deadline-driven and comfortable in a busy environment Why you'll love this role: 20 days annual leave plus Public Holidays and loyalty days (up to 5 additional days) Yearly pension review Employee Assistance Programme (including immediate family members) Employee discounts platform (groceries, holidays, wellness, sports and more) Death in Service (3x salary) after 6 months Private Medical Scheme eligibility after 1 year Enhanced pension contributions (9%) after 1 year How to apply: If you have relevant experience, please get in touch today.
